The Necessity of Adaptive Testing Tools and Limitations of Traditional Methods

The Necessity of Adaptive Testing Tools and Limitations of Traditional Methods

The Necessity of Adaptive Testing Tools and Limitations of Traditional Methods

Traditional assessment methods, such as standardized tests and exams, often emphasize rote memorization over critical thinking and problem-solving skills. They may not accommodate diverse learning styles and can limit opportunities for students to demonstrate their full understanding and abilities.

  • Standardized Testing: Traditional tests apply the same set of questions to all students, failing to account for individual learning styles and paces. This uniform approach can lead to disengagement and does not cater to each student's unique needs.

  • Manual Grading: Grading by hand is labor-intensive and can delay feedback, hindering timely interventions to support student improvement.

  • Limited Data Insights: Conventional methods often lack the analytical depth required to fully understand each student's learning journey, making it challenging to tailor instruction effectively.

The Emergence of Adaptive Testing Solutions:

Adaptive testing tools leverage artificial intelligence to create dynamic assessments that adjust in real-time to a student's performance. This personalization ensures that each learner is appropriately challenged and supported, addressing the limitations of traditional assessments.

Adaptive testing tools are revolutionizing education by providing personalized assessments and streamlining administrative tasks. Here's an overview of five leading platforms, highlighting their key features, advantages, and potential drawbacks:​

1. VEGA AI

Overview: VEGA AI is a comprehensive educational platform that leverages artificial intelligence to enhance teaching and learning experiences. It offers tools for adaptive test creation, automated grading, and personalized learning pathways, aiming to make education more efficient and tailored to individual student needs.​

Pros:

  • Adaptive Test Creation: Automatically generates assessments that adjust to student performance, ensuring appropriate challenge levels.​

  • Instant Grading: Provides immediate feedback, allowing educators to quickly identify and address learning gaps.​

  • Personalized Learning Paths: Tailors educational content to each student's needs, promoting more effective learning.​

  • 24/7 AI Tutor Support: Offers continuous support through AI avatars, ensuring students receive guidance outside traditional classroom hours.​

Cons:

  • Learning Curve: Educators may require initial training to fully utilize all features, which could be time-consuming.​

2. Disco

Overview: Disco integrates AI with social learning to create dynamic educational experiences. It focuses on operational efficiency, community engagement, and thoughtful design to make learning more impactful.

Pros:

  • AI-Powered Assessments: Automates grading and evaluation, reducing manual effort.​

  • Integrated Feedback and Community: Connects learners with actionable insights while fostering collaboration.​

  • Smart Automations: Streamlines repetitive tasks for program operators, saving valuable time.​

  • Intuitive Tools for Creators: Facilitates the design of quizzes, peer-review activities, and live workshops through a user-friendly interface.​

Cons:

  • Niche Focus: Primarily designed for community-driven learning environments, which may not suit all educational settings.​

3. Gradescope

Overview: Gradescope is an AI-driven grading platform initially developed for higher education. It simplifies the grading process with a focus on fairness and efficiency, supporting various assignment types and providing detailed analytics.​

Pros:

  • AI-Assisted Grading: Groups similar answers to streamline evaluation and reduce manual effort.​

  • Dynamic Rubrics: Allows adjustments to rubrics, automatically updating previously graded work for consistency.​

  • LMS Integration: Seamlessly connects with platforms like Canvas, Blackboard, and Moodle.​

  • Performance Insights: Offers detailed analytics to track progress and identify areas needing support.​

Cons:

  • Limited Applicability: Focused mainly on higher education and may not cater to all grade levels.​

4. Coursebox

Overview: Coursebox is an all-in-one learning and grading platform with AI capabilities. It enables educators to create and grade courses efficiently, offering tools for instant quiz creation, automated grading, and real-time analytics.

Pros:

  • AI-Generated Assessments: Creates assessments in minutes, aligning with course material and learning goals.

  • AI Chatbot: Provides instant feedback and assistance to learners, enhancing engagement.​

  • AI Quiz Generator: Generates long-answer assignment questions and quizzes quickly.​

  • LMS Integration: Integrates with Moodle, D2L, Blackboard, and Canvas.​

Cons:

  • LMS Dependency: May require integration with existing LMS platforms, which could complicate setup.​

5. Kangaroos AI

Overview: Kangaroos AI focuses on simplifying grading and lesson planning for educators. It offers AI-powered essay grading, customizable rubrics, and bulk assignment processing, aiming to enhance efficiency without compromising quality.​

Pros:

  • Customizable Rubrics: Allows adaptation of grading criteria to meet course-specific needs.​

  • Bulk Assignment Processing: Enables grading of multiple essays or assignments simultaneously.​

  • AI-Enabled Lesson Planning: Assists in quickly creating engaging lesson plans.​

  • User-Friendly Interface: Designed for quick adoption without a steep learning curve.​

Cons:

  • Setup Complexity: May have a learning curve associated with setting up assignments and rubrics.​

Each of these platforms offers unique features tailored to different educational needs. Educators should consider their specific requirements and the context of their teaching environment when selecting an adaptive testing tool.
